Furnace Starts Then Shuts Off After a Few Seconds in Cordes Lakes, AZ

A furnace that initiates the startup sequence and shuts off within seconds almost always has a flame sensor problem in Cordes Lakes. The furnace ignites the burners, the flame sensor fails to confirm the flame within the safety window, and the control board shuts the gas valve as a safety measure in Cordes Lakes, AZ. Flame sensor cleaning or replacement addresses this in most cases in Cordes Lakes.

Why Carbon Monoxide Is the Specific Risk of a Faulty Furnace in Cordes Lakes

Carbon monoxide is the combustion byproduct that presents the most serious immediate safety risk from a faulty gas furnace in Cordes Lakes, AZ. It is colorless and odorless in Cordes Lakes. A correctly operating gas furnace with an intact heat exchanger exhausts all combustion gases to the outside in Cordes Lakes, AZ. A furnace with a cracked heat exchanger allows combustion gases to enter the circulated air in Cordes Lakes.

Gas Leak Signs and the Correct Response in Cordes Lakes, AZ

A rotten egg or sulfur smell near the furnace or gas lines indicates a gas leak in Cordes Lakes. The correct response is to not operate any electrical switches, evacuate the home, and call the gas utility from outside in Cordes Lakes, AZ. Do not re-enter until the gas utility has confirmed the situation is safe in Cordes Lakes.

Failed or Dirty Flame Sensor in Cordes Lakes

The flame sensor confirms a flame is present before the control board allows the gas valve to stay open in Cordes Lakes, AZ. Oxidation on the sensor rod reduces its electrical conductivity over time, causing a signal too weak to satisfy the control board in Cordes Lakes. The control board shuts the gas valve as a safety measure, producing the furnace that starts and shuts off within seconds symptom in Cordes Lakes, AZ.

Failed Hot Surface Igniter in Cordes Lakes, AZ

The hot surface igniter is a fragile ceramic component that glows red-hot to ignite the gas burners in Cordes Lakes. Igniters become brittle over time from thermal cycling and crack or fail from physical shock in Cordes Lakes, AZ. A failed igniter produces no glow and no ignition in Cordes Lakes.

Cracked Heat Exchanger in Cordes Lakes

The heat exchanger separates the combustion gases from the circulated air in Cordes Lakes, AZ. A cracked heat exchanger allows combustion gases including carbon monoxide to cross into the circulated air and be distributed throughout the home by the blower in Cordes Lakes. A confirmed cracked heat exchanger means the furnace should not be operated until the heat exchanger or furnace is replaced in Cordes Lakes, AZ.

Blower Motor and Capacitor Failure in Cordes Lakes, AZ

A failed blower motor produces no airflow despite the combustion system operating correctly, causing the heat exchanger to overheat and the high-limit switch to trip in Cordes Lakes. A failing blower capacitor causes the motor to struggle to start or fail to start entirely in Cordes Lakes, AZ.

Control Board and Thermostat Faults in Cordes Lakes

The control board manages ignition sequencing, blower timing, safety switch monitoring, and fault code storage in Cordes Lakes, AZ. A failed control board can produce a wide range of symptoms depending on which function it was managing in Cordes Lakes.

Limit Switch Trips From Overheating in Cordes Lakes, AZ

The high-limit switch shuts the furnace off if the heat exchanger temperature exceeds the safe maximum in Cordes Lakes. It trips consistently when the heat exchanger is reaching unsafe temperatures, almost always from restricted airflow in Cordes Lakes, AZ. A dirty air filter is the most common cause in Cordes Lakes.

A banging or booming sound at furnace startup indicates delayed ignition in Cordes Lakes. Gas accumulates in the combustion chamber before the burners ignite because the burner ports are partially blocked by combustion deposits in Cordes Lakes, AZ. When ignition finally occurs, the accumulated gas ignites with a small explosion in Cordes Lakes. Delayed ignition is hard on the heat exchanger and warrants prompt burner cleaning in Cordes Lakes, AZ.
Yes. A severely restricted air filter reduces the airflow through the heat exchanger below the minimum required for safe operation in Cordes Lakes. The heat exchanger temperature rises to the point where the high-limit switch trips and shuts the furnace off in Cordes Lakes, AZ. Replacing the filter allows the furnace to restart in Cordes Lakes.
